Polaris Classic Snowmobile Seat?
I am looking to upgrade from my 1995 XLT triple and am looking at early 2003 and up Polaris Classic's - hopefully a 800. I do have my 4 year old son ride with me quite a bit - and was wondering if you can simply add the "second" seat to a classic and make it a "touring" sled. I know it was pretty easy on an old John Deere Trailfire my dad had when I was a kid. If anyone knows please drop me an answer.
Thank you!!
Yes... You can add simply add the "second" seat, to a 2003 Polaris Classic... All you need to do, is to pick the company, you want to purchase the second seat kit from. Many companies handle these, for example, Dennis Kirk, and so on. You can go on the internet, and type in the item you want, in this case, it would be the second seat, for a 2003 Polaris Classic, and, all kinds of dealers will come up, on the screen. However, these will be "after market" add ons, from these companies.and, sometimes, they don't fit properly, causing the owner to have to modify things, so it will fit. And, for what a person has to pay, for these items, they should fit, exactly, with no modifications, what so ever, at least in my opnion, anyway. Further more, what it will cost you, for the sled, itself, is a something, as well. You don't want to have to pay a lot of money, for the sled, just to have to modify it, so a "after market" item fits correctly, right? So, what I would do, is to go to the local Polaris dealer, and price the "second" seat kit, right from the Polaris dealer, themselves. True, it may cost more, from the Plolaris dealer, but, getting it right from them, insures a perfect fit, cause it was made by Polaris... For Polaris. No modifing needed.
